Define Clear Goals
Overview: Setting clear, measurable goals is the first step in any successful online advertising campaign. Goals help you determine the direction of your campaign and measure its success.
Strategies:
- Specific Goals: Define increasing website traffic, generating leads, or boosting sales.
- Measurable Metrics: Identify key performance indicators (KPIs) to track progress, such as click-through rates (CTR), conversion rates, and return on ad spend (ROAS).
- Achievable Targets: Set realistic and achievable targets based on your budget and resources.
- Time-Bound Objectives: Establish a timeline for achieving your goals to keep your campaign on track.
Example: A goal could be to increase website traffic by 20% within three months using targeted Facebook ads.
Know Your Audience
Overview: Understanding your target audience is crucial for creating relevant and compelling ads. Knowing your audience helps you tailor your message and reach the right people.
Strategies:
- Demographic Research: Gather data on your audience’s age, gender, location, and income level.
- Psychographic Insights: Understand your audience’s interests, behaviors, and values.
- Customer Personas: Create detailed customer personas to represent different segments of your audience.
- Competitor Analysis: Analyze your competitors to see who they are targeting and how.
Example: Use Google Analytics to analyze your website’s audience demographics and interests, then create customer personas to guide your ad targeting.
Choose the Right Platforms
Overview: Selecting the right advertising platforms is essential to reach your target audience effectively. Each platform offers different advantages and reaches different demographics.
Platforms:
- Google Ads: Ideal for reaching users searching for related products or services.
- Facebook and Instagram Ads: Great for targeting specific demographics and interests.
- LinkedIn Ads: Best for B2B marketing and professional audiences.
- Twitter Ads: Useful for real-time engagement and reaching younger audiences.
- Pinterest Ads: Effective for visual products and reaching a predominantly female audience.
Example: A fashion brand might choose to focus on Instagram and Pinterest ads to reach fashion-conscious, visually oriented users.
Create Compelling Ad Copy
Overview: Effective ad copy captures attention, conveys your message clearly, and prompts users to take action.
Strategies:
- Attention-Grabbing Headlines: Use bold, clear headlines highlighting the main benefit or offer.
- Value Proposition: Clearly state what makes your product or service unique and valuable.
- Strong Call-to-Action (CTA): Include a clear and compelling CTA that encourages users to take the desired action.
- Concise and Clear: Keep your ad copy concise and easy to understand, avoiding jargon and complex language.
Example: An ad for a fitness app might have a headline like “Get Fit at Home,” followed by “Join 100,000+ Users and Start Your Free Trial Today!”
Design Visually Appealing Ads
Overview: Visually appealing ads capture attention and can significantly impact ad performance.
Strategies:
- High-Quality Images: Use high-resolution images relevant to your product or service.
- Consistent Branding: Ensure your ads align with your brand’s visual identity, including colors, fonts, and logos.
- Minimalist Design: Avoid clutter, keep the design clean, and focus on the main message.
- Eye-Catching Visuals: Use striking visuals or animations to stand out in users’ feeds.
Example: A travel agency might attract attention by using stunning, high-quality images of travel destinations with minimal text.
Utilize Targeting Options
Overview: Advanced targeting options allow you to reach your ideal audience more effectively.
Strategies:
- Demographic Targeting: Target users based on age, gender, income, and other demographic factors.
- Interest Targeting: Reach users based on their interests and behaviors.
- Geographic Targeting: Focus your ads on specific locations to reach local customers.
- Behavioral Targeting: Use past behavior data to target users interested in similar products or services.
Example: An online bookstore might target users who have shown interest in reading and literature on Facebook.
Leverage Remarketing
Overview: Remarketing helps you re-engage users who have previously interacted with your website or ads but have yet to convert.
Strategies:
- Website Visitors: Target users who visit your website but have yet to make a purchase.
- Cart Abandonment: Focus on users who added items to their cart but still need to complete the purchase.
- Engagement Retargeting: Reach users who are engaged with your ads or social media content.
- Custom Audiences: Create custom audiences based on your CRM data or email lists.
Example: A retailer might use remarketing to show discount ads to users who abandoned their shopping cart.
A/B Testing
Overview: A/B testing involves running two versions of an ad to see which performs better. It helps optimize ad performance by identifying the most effective elements.
Strategies:
- Test Variables: Experiment with headlines, images, CTAs, and ad copy.
- Monitor Results: Track the performance of each variation and compare metrics like CTR, conversion rate, and cost per conversion.
- Iterate and Optimize: Use the insights gained from A/B testing to refine and improve your ads continuously.
Example: Test two headlines for a Google Ad to see which drives more clicks and conversions.
Optimize Landing Pages
Overview: A well-optimized landing page can significantly improve conversion rates by providing a seamless user experience.
Strategies:
- Consistency: Ensure your landing page matches the ad’s message and design for a cohesive experience.
- Clear CTA: Place a prominent and compelling CTA on your landing page.
- Fast Load Times: Optimize your landing page to load quickly and reduce bounce rates.
- Mobile-Friendly Design: Ensure your landing page is fully optimized for mobile devices.
Example: A software company might create a dedicated landing page for a PPC campaign with a clear CTA to download a free trial.
Monitor and Analyze Performance
Overview: Regularly monitoring and analyzing your ad performance helps you understand what’s working and where to improve.
Strategies:
- Use Analytics Tools: Leverage tools like Google Analytics, Facebook Ads Manager, and others to track ad performance.
- Key Metrics: Focus on CTR, conversion rate, ROAS, and cost per acquisition (CPA).
- Adjust and Optimize: Use the insights gained from analytics to make data-driven decisions and optimize your campaigns.
Example: Regularly review your ad campaigns’ performance in Google Analytics and adjust targeting, ad copy, or bidding strategies based on the data.
